AntDesignPro开发指南:快速入门与关键技术
3星 · 超过75%的资源 需积分: 35 57 浏览量
更新于2024-07-18
4
收藏 300KB DOC 举报
AntDesignPro开发手册是一份全面指南,旨在帮助开发者快速理解和上手蚂蚁金服出品的前端设计解决方案。该框架的核心技术包括使用ES2015+的JavaScript语言标准,React作为构建用户界面的主要库,以及DVA,这是一个对Redux(状态管理)、React Router(路由管理)和Redux Saga(异步操作处理)的轻量级封装。此外,G2是一个基于可视化编码的图形库,而Ant Design则是React组件的开发环境。
手册详细介绍了如何安装和配置AntDesignPro所需的环境。首先,推荐使用Node.js,可以从官方网站下载最新版本并根据指示进行安装。有两种方法可供选择:一是直接从GitHub克隆Ant Design Pro的代码库,二是通过ant-design-pro-cli工具进行脚手架安装,这提供了更便捷的项目初始化过程。
项目结构方面,手册列出了一个典型的AntDesignPro项目组织架构,包括mock文件夹用于存储本地模拟数据,public目录存放共享资源,如网站图标,src目录下按照功能模块划分,如common(应用通用配置)、components(业务通用组件)、e2e(集成测试)、layouts(布局管理)、models(数据交互)、routes(业务页面入口)等,展示了组件和模块的层次结构。
在配置部分,开发者需要关注theme.js(主题配置),g2.js(可视化图形配置),index.ejs(HTML入口模板),index.js(应用入口)和index.less(全局样式)等关键文件,这些文件有助于定制化项目外观和行为。同时,router.js负责路由管理,确保用户界面的导航逻辑清晰。
AntDesignPro开发手册提供了一个完整的入门路径,无论是对于初次接触此框架的开发者,还是想要深入理解其内部机制的专家,都是一个宝贵的资源。通过遵循手册中的指导,开发者可以高效地构建和管理基于Ant Design Pro的高质量前端应用程序。
2019-07-30 上传
2019-09-23 上传
2020-12-13 上传
2021-09-13 上传
2021-12-13 上传
2021-09-13 上传
2022-10-26 上传
2022-10-27 上传
点击了解资源详情
潇子默
- 粉丝: 2
- 资源: 21
最新资源
- WordPress作为新闻管理面板的实现指南
- NPC_Generator:使用Ruby打造的游戏角色生成器
- MATLAB实现变邻域搜索算法源码解析
- 探索C++并行编程:使用INTEL TBB的项目实践
- 玫枫跟打器:网页版五笔打字工具,提升macOS打字效率
- 萨尔塔·阿萨尔·希塔斯:SATINDER项目解析
- 掌握变邻域搜索算法:MATLAB代码实践
- saaraansh: 简化法律文档,打破语言障碍的智能应用
- 探索牛角交友盲盒系统:PHP开源交友平台的新选择
- 探索Nullfactory-SSRSExtensions: 强化SQL Server报告服务
- Lotide:一套JavaScript实用工具库的深度解析
- 利用Aurelia 2脚手架搭建新项目的快速指南
- 变邻域搜索算法Matlab实现教程
- 实战指南:构建高效ES+Redis+MySQL架构解决方案
- GitHub Pages入门模板快速启动指南
- NeonClock遗产版:包名更迭与应用更新